Gebe Cuscus vs Kouprey
Phalanger alexandrae compared with Bos sauveli
Key Differences
- Gebe Cuscus is Endangered while Kouprey is Critically Endangered.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gebe Cuscus | Kouprey |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(动物界) | Animalia (动物界)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索动物门) | Chordata (脊索动物门) |
| Class same | Mammalia (哺乳動物) | Mammalia (哺乳動物) |
| Order | Diprotodontia (雙門齒目) | Artiodactyla (偶蹄目) |
| Family | Phalangeridae | Bovidae (Bovids) |
| Genus | Phalanger | Bos (Cattle & Bison) |
| Species | Phalanger alexandrae | Bos sauveli |
Evolutionary Relationship
Gebe Cuscus and Kouprey share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(哺乳動物)
